Dhurandhar has achieved a record-breaking second week at the box office, surpassing the collections of Pathaan and Gadar 2. The film, starring Ranveer Singh and others, earned ₹253 crore in its second week, bringing its total to ₹463.48 crore. Despite a slow start to its third week, Dhurandhar continues to compete as Avatar Fire And Ash gains momentum.
